1. A computer workstation system for ultrasound examination of a patient'"'"'s breast, comprising:
- a storage system for an image dataset in the form of a plurality of two-dimensional scan images representative of a chestwardly compressed breast sonographically scanned using an automated three-dimensional breast ultrasound acquisition system;
a processor configured to;
(a) generate a three-dimensional volumetric dataset based on said image dataset;
(b) segment and filter said three-dimensional volumetric dataset; and
(c) generate a two-dimensional coronal guide image based on the segmented and filtered three-dimensional volumetric dataset, wherein said two-dimensional guide image includes visually enhanced suspected abnormalities within said segmented and filtered three-dimensional volumetric dataset if present in the breast; and
an interactive user interface configured to;
(a) electronically display to a user said coronal guide image;
(b) receive user input indicating a user'"'"'s selection of a suspected abnormality; and
(c) in response to the user'"'"'s selection displaying one or more of the plurality of two-dimensional scan images corresponding to the selected suspected abnormality.

Abstract
A method and system for processing and displaying breast ultrasound information is described. A 2D feature weighted volumetric coronal image as a “guide” or “road map” is generated from the 3D ultrasound data volume to represent the 3D dataset with the goal of emphasizing abnormalities within the breast while excluding non-breast structures, particularly those external to the breast such as ribs and chest wall.
